From cdb6dfdc8db004d8303f3b763e5b83b2a27e0f62 Mon Sep 17 00:00:00 2001 From: Hyuk Lee Date: Thu, 17 Mar 2016 17:45:24 +0900 Subject: [PATCH] Launch bluetooth-frwk service after multi-user.target in TM1 Change-Id: I215cf08c1ba3177d7eb9a1fee156e107a4dc29dc Signed-off-by: Hyuk Lee --- packaging/bluetooth-frwk-mobile-sprd.service | 12 ++++++++++++ packaging/bluetooth-frwk.spec | 4 ++++ 2 files changed, 16 insertions(+) create mode 100644 packaging/bluetooth-frwk-mobile-sprd.service diff --git a/packaging/bluetooth-frwk-mobile-sprd.service b/packaging/bluetooth-frwk-mobile-sprd.service new file mode 100644 index 0000000..d902ce5 --- /dev/null +++ b/packaging/bluetooth-frwk-mobile-sprd.service @@ -0,0 +1,12 @@ +[Unit] +Description=Bluetooth service +After=multi-user.target + +[Service] +Type=dbus +BusName=org.projectx.bt +ExecStart=/usr/bin/bt-service +KillMode=process + +[Install] +WantedBy=multi-user.target diff --git a/packaging/bluetooth-frwk.spec b/packaging/bluetooth-frwk.spec index a435491..eebefa8 100644 --- a/packaging/bluetooth-frwk.spec +++ b/packaging/bluetooth-frwk.spec @@ -123,7 +123,11 @@ export FFLAGS="$FFLAGS -DTIZEN_DEBUG_ENABLE" %if "%{?profile}" == "mobile" export CFLAGS="$CFLAGS -DTIZEN_NETWORK_TETHERING_ENABLE -DTIZEN_BT_FLIGHTMODE_ENABLED -DTIZEN_MOBILE -DTIZEN_TELEPHONY_ENABLED" +%if "%{?tizen_target_name}" == "TM1" +%define _servicefile packaging/bluetooth-frwk-mobile-sprd.service +%else %define _servicefile packaging/bluetooth-frwk-mobile.service +%endif %define _servicedir multi-user.target.wants %endif -- 2.7.4